Crime overview

Brigstock Road area has the highest crime rate of 100 local areas in Bensham Manor , and the 7th highest crime rate of 1,082 local areas in Croydon .

This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.

The overall crime rate in the area around Brigstock Road (CR7 8SR) in the last 12 months was 1220.9 per 1,000 residents and was 1230.3% higher than the Bensham Manor average (91.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 52 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other crime with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Shoplifting ( 156.3% YoY). The sharpest decline was Anti-social behaviour ( -62.7%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 81 (≈ 496.9 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 26.6%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-17.8%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Brigstock Road (CR7 8SR), the main crime hotspot is near Supermarket. Police recorded 199 crimes here, including 81 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
